Key Takeaways

  • Bitcoin stabilizes near an all-time high, despite ongoing market caution.
  • DeFi protocols confront liquidity challenges exacerbated by rising gas fees.
  • Recent EU regulations provoke mixed reactions among crypto investors.

What Happened

Today’s crypto market reflected a mix of optimism and caution as Bitcoin approached resistance at around $68,000 following a rally. Reported by CoinDesk, Bitcoin had been facing a notable liquidity crunch, particularly within Decentralized Finance (DeFi) sectors, driven by high gas fees that intensified the challenges for many protocols. Meanwhile, discussions emerged among NFT marketplaces regarding potential fee cuts to attract users amid declining interest.

Why It Matters

This mixed landscape is underscored by investors’ cautious behavior amidst macroeconomic headwinds, with Bitcoin and Ethereum logging their worst start to the year in recorded history. Both cryptocurrencies have seen substantial declines, with Bitcoin down about 24% year-to-date—hovering around $67,000, while Ethereum has fallen to approximately $2,000, experiencing a similar loss trajectory. The situation remains critical as liquidity becomes a focal point of interest amid recent developments in the EU concerning crypto regulatory frameworks. What’s Next / Market Impact

As both Bitcoin and Ethereum continue to navigate through this turbulent phase, the outlook remains cautious. With a significant outflow from spot Bitcoin ETFs—reportedly totaling $4 billion over the past five weeks—traders are adapting by reducing leverage and preserving liquidity. Analysts predict a potential breakout for Bitcoin, particularly as it compresses within a symmetrical triangle formation near the $66,000 to $68,000 range. However, the pressure on altcoins appears to be more intense, as coins like XRP and Dogecoin are anticipated to struggle in 2026 given the lack of compelling catalysts for recovery compared to Bitcoin and Ethereum, which might rebound as their fundamentals strengthen, according to market analysts. This evolving scenario requires continuous monitoring, particularly as institutional investments remain a barometer for market health as we move forward into a new trading cycle.
